OpenObserve
A cloud-native observability platform that unifies logs, metrics, traces, and session replays into a single interface, offering up to 140x lower storage costs compared to Elasticsearch.
What You Can Do After Deployment
- Visit your domain — Access the OpenObserve web UI and log in with your root user credentials
- Ingest logs — Send logs from your applications using the built-in ingestion APIs or popular agents like Fluentd, Vector, and OpenTelemetry
- Create dashboards — Build custom dashboards to visualize your metrics, logs, and traces
- Set up alerts — Configure alert rules to get notified when issues arise in your infrastructure
- Explore traces — Analyze distributed traces to understand request flows across your microservices
Key Features
- Unified platform for logs, metrics, traces, and session replays
- Up to 140x lower storage costs compared to Elasticsearch
- Built-in SQL query engine for powerful log analysis
- Custom dashboard builder with various visualization types
- Real-time alerting with configurable notification channels
- OpenTelemetry native support for traces and metrics
- Compatible with popular log shippers like Fluentd, Vector, and Filebeat
- Role-based access control for team collaboration
- Session replay for frontend monitoring
- Written in Rust for high performance and low resource usage
License
AGPL-3.0 — GitHub